About

Valencia Birding was founded in 2011 by Sheffield-born guide David Warrington, who relocated to eastern Spain and built a tailor-made guiding service from the towns of Xàtiva and Dénia. The company covers Valencia, Alicante and into Castilla-La Mancha, working a stretch of Mediterranean coast and inland steppe that mixes wetlands, sierras, salinas and rice fields into one of Europe's most underrated birding regions. All trips are run privately for the individual, couple or small group that books them, with day excursions, short breaks and multi-day holidays on offer. Specialities include White-headed Duck and Red-knobbed Coot at El Hondo and La Mata, raptors such as Bonelli's and Golden Eagle in the limestone hills, and steppe birds including Great Bustard on day trips to the Castilian plains.
